Retired RBI Employee Fatally Stabbed in Delhi Home; Two Suspects Apprehended
In a shocking incident in New Delhi, the family of retired Reserve Bank of India (RBI) employee Madho Ram has alleged that he was brutally killed during a robbery at his residence on Mandir Marg this past Sunday. The tragic event has left the family in profound grief and financial turmoil, raising serious concerns about safety in the capital.
Discovery of the Crime and Police Investigation
Around 5:30 PM, Ram was discovered in a room of his home with multiple stab wounds, lying in a pool of blood. According to reports, an electrician who visited the house later found the victim and immediately alerted neighbors, who then contacted the police. Authorities swiftly responded to the scene, initiating a thorough investigation into the circumstances surrounding the death.
Police have arrested two individuals in connection with the case: Azad Khan and his wife, Rubina. Both are known to the Ram family for an extended period, spanning 15 to 20 years, which has added a layer of betrayal to the tragedy. While preliminary police statements suggest the motive may be linked to a money-lending dispute, the victim's family strongly contests this, asserting that robbery was the primary intent.
Family's Allegations and Financial Distress
The victim's son, Siddhant, aged 26, provided detailed accounts to the media, alleging that valuable items were stolen during the incident. He stated, "A gold chain, two to three rings, and a significant amount of cash were taken after my father was stabbed." This loss has exacerbated the family's already precarious financial situation, as they relied heavily on Ram's pension for their livelihood.
Siddhant, who is currently pursuing a Bachelor of Arts through the School of Open Learning (SOL), expressed deep anguish over the impact on their future plans. "With my father's death, our future looks uncertain. My education and my sister's marriage arrangements are now in serious jeopardy," he lamented. The family had been preparing for his sister's wedding, making the sudden loss even more devastating.
Suspicious Activities and Trust Betrayed
Siddhant further alleged that Azad Khan had conducted two to three reconnaissance visits on the day of the incident, apparently to ascertain when Ram would be alone at home. "He had earned our trust over the years and used to visit frequently. No one suspected him of any malicious intent," Siddhant revealed, highlighting how the suspect exploited their long-standing relationship.
According to Siddhant's account, the attack occurred when his mother was preparing to leave for a function. His father had asked for water, and Khan, who had arrived at that moment, offered to provide it. Siddhant claimed that Khan had brought a pair of scissors with the intent to kill and might have attacked Ram while he was asleep, indicating premeditation.
Police Findings and Evidence Tampering
In their investigation, police reported that Rubina admitted to attempting to destroy evidence by washing Khan's blood-stained clothes. This admission points to efforts to conceal the crime, adding complexity to the case. Authorities are continuing to gather evidence and interview witnesses to build a strong legal case against the accused.
